Among one of the most important elements of ESP systems is their private components, which consist of motors, pumps, cables, and control systems. Each element plays a critical role in the general capability of the ESP configuration. As an example, the motor is accountable for driving the pump, transforming electrical power into mechanical energy that relocates the liquid upwards. Selecting high-quality ESP electric motor parts is vital for making sure that the pump runs at optimal effectiveness. Robust style and building of the motor ensure it can endure long term direct exposure to details oilfield problems, consisting of temperature level variants and destructive atmospheres.

Along with the motor, various ESP components add to the liquid transport mechanism. The pump itself is crafted to take care of certain flow prices and fluid types while giving an ideal lifting capability. The choice of products ends up being critical in making certain that the pump can withstand deterioration triggered by rough fluids or destructive chemicals commonly present in oil and gas extraction. Choosing oilfield ESP parts manufactured to rigorous requirements helps in reducing the threat of unexpected downtimes due to equipment failing, therefore saving time and boosting productivity.

An additional critical component of the ESP system is the cable television, which connects the motor to the power supply. High-quality ESP wires likewise enhance energy performance, making sure that optimal power is provided to the motor without significant losses.
